I would like to know if I can freeze left over fresh herbs. I always have to purchase more than the receipe calls for.Yes, you can freeze left over fresh herbs. They can be frozen in plastic freezer or ziplock bags. Because they cannot be refrozen, you should divide into portions as much as you are likely to use at a time. They keep for several months, and the colour keeps well, but they will lose firmness on thawing and you can only use them in hot dishes in which do not require herbs of a fresh, firm consistency.
